Women in Especially Difficult Circumstances. For purposes of this Act, "Women in Especially Difficult Circumstances" (WEDC) shall refer to victims and survivors of sexual and physical abuse, illegal recruitment, prostitution, trafficking, armed conflict, women in detention, victims and survivors of rape and incest, and such other related circumstances which have incapacitated them functionally. Local government units are there fore mandated to deliver the necessary services and interventions to WEDC under their respective jurisdictions. SEC. 31. Services and Interventions. WEDC shall be provided with services and interventions as necessary such as, but not limited to, the following: (a) Temporary and protective custody; (b) Medical and dental services (c) Psychological evaluation; (d) Counseling; (e) Psychiatric evaluation; (1) Legal services; (g) Productivity skills capability building; (h) Livelihood assistance; i) Job placement; ) Financial assistance; and (k) Transportation assistance. SEC. 32. Protection of Girl-Children. - (a) The State shall pursue measures to eliminate all forms of discrimination against girl-children in education, health and nutrition, and skills development. (b) Girl-children shall be protected from all forms o abuse and exploitation. 28
